Is Methadone Suggested After Undergoing Fusion In Lower Back And Laminectomy?

I have had 2 nack surgeries a fusion in lower back and a laminectomy before that. I am in chronic pain and need help in the Wisconsin, Milwaukee area. I am currently taking methadone and need to find a new doctor within a month... please help.-Andrew

Orthopaedic Surgeon 's  Response
Hello,

I have studied your case.

If your new MRI shows disc bulge with nerve compression then surgery may help.

For these symptoms analgesic and neurotropic medication can be started along with methadone.
Till time, avoid lifting weights, Sit with support to back. You can consult physiotherapist for help.
Physiotherapy like ultrasound and TENS therapy will help

I will advise to check your vit B12 and vit D3 level.
